Erb's palsy occurs when there is an injury to the brachial plexus which is a nerve group that provide movement and sensation to the arm, hand, and fingers. This condition often results from negligence in medical care and also during labor and birth. If you believe that your child is suffering from this condition and it is due to medical mistakes committed by doctors, hospitals or nurses, you may be eligible to file an action against the responsible person.

Many of Erb's palsy lawyers are employed by national law firms that deal with birth injuries with local offices. Attorneys at these firms have an excellent understanding of the laws of each state and can help you file your lawsuit within the time limit for your area.

In the case of difficult or complicated births medical professionals might apply too much pressure on the neck, head, feet, and shoulders of the baby to assist in delivering it through the birth canal. This could cause the baby's neck and shoulder nerves to hurt due to being pulled too excessively.

Erb's palsy affects brachialplexus, which is the infant's neck, shoulders, and arms. The brachialplexus comprises a network of nerves that connects muscles and the brain. This nerve system can cause muscle weakness, which can hinder a baby from moving their arm.

This condition is caused by medical errors or negligence which leads to a traumatic birth. Many cases of erb's paralysis are preventable and can be avoided with proper monitoring and treatment during labor, pregnancy, and delivery process.

Shoulder dystocia is a possibility during complicated deliveries or breech presentations. It happens when medical professionals have to swiftly pull the baby out of the birth canal or apply force to get a baby born breech out of the pelvic bone of the mother's, which can stretch the upper and shoulder nerves.
